Possible Causes of Water Damage in Blossom Valley
Water damage in Blossom Valley can occur from a variety of sources, often unexpectedly. One of the most common causes is plumbing failures, such as burst pipes or leaking fixtures, which can lead to significant water intrusion in residential and commercial properties. Heavy rains and storms, prevalent in the area, can also overwhelm drainage systems, resulting in flooding that damages floors, walls, and personal belongings.
Another frequent cause is appliance malfunctions, including malfunctioning water heaters or washing machines. These issues can cause internal leaks that go unnoticed until extensive damage has occurred. Additionally, poor sealing around windows and doors, along with aging infrastructure, can allow water to seep into vulnerable areas, leading to mold growth and structural compromise over time.

What are the different categories of water damage?
Water damage is generally classified into three categories. Category 1 involves clean, potable water from sources like broken pipes or faulty appliances. Category 2 includes gray water, which may contain contaminants and pose health risks, such as from dishwasher leaks or failed sump pumps. Category 3 is considered black water, which is highly contaminated and associated with sewage backups or floodwaters. Proper assessment ensures we use the right methods for each category.

What should I do before professional help arrives?
First, turn off the water source if it’s still active to prevent further flooding. Remove any valuable or fragile items from the affected areas to minimize additional damage. Avoid using electrical appliances in water-affected areas, and keep a safe distance until our professionals arrive to handle the situation safely and effectively.
How do I prevent future water damage?
Regular maintenance and inspections of plumbing and appliances can catch issues early. Ensuring proper sealing around windows and doors helps prevent water intrusion during storms. Additionally, installing sump pumps and backflow preventers can protect your property from flooding.
